﻿body 
{ 
    background-image: url(App_Themes/MPBlue/images/bg.gif);
    margin-left:0;
    margin-right:0;
    margin-top:0;    
}

.forTexts
{
	font-family: Tahoma, Verdana;
	font-size: 10px;
	color: #333333;
	line-height: 20px;
	text-align: justify;
}

td.TopBG
{
    background-color: #5b6db5;
    height:12px;
}

td.Header
{
    background-image: url(./images/Logo.JPG);
    height: 55px;
    background-repeat: no-repeat;
    text-align: center;
}

td.Footer
{
	height: 40px;
	background-image: url(./Images/Bottom_bg.Gif);
	font-family: Tahoma,Verdana;
	font-size: 10px;
	color: white;
	text-align: center;
	vertical-align: middle;
}

td.Bar
{
    background-image:url(./Images/Menu_BG.gif);
    height:22px;
    font-family: Tahoma,Verdana;
    font-size: 10px;
    line-height: 20px;
}

td.LeftMenu
{
    background-color:#f7ecd0; 
    vertical-align:top;  
}

td.MenuHeader
{
	background-color: #7d6a4b;
	height: 20px;
	font-family: Tahoma,Verdana;
	font-size: 11px;
	color: #FFFFFF;
	text-align: center;
	font-weight: bold;
	border-style: outset;
	border-width: 1px;
	border-color: #D9E3EE;
}

td.PanelHeader
{
    font-family: Tahoma, Verdana;
    font-size: 12px;
    color: #003366;
    text-align: justify;
    font-weight: bold;
}

td.Panel
{
	background-color: #f7ecd0;
	font-family: Tahoma, Verdana;
	font-size: 10px;
	color: #333333;
	line-height: 20px;
	text-align: justify;
	border-color: #673b23;
	border-style: solid;
	border-width: 1px;
	padding: 5px;
	line-height: 14px;
}

td.PanelUser
{
    background-color: #f7ecd0;
    font-family: Tahoma, Verdana;
    font-size: 10px;
    color: #333333;
    line-height: 20px;
    text-align:left ;
    border-color: #673b23;
    border-style: solid;
    border-width: 1px;
    padding :5px;
    line-height:14px;
}

td.Panel1
{
    background-color: #EFF3F8;
    font-family: Tahoma, Verdana;
    font-size: 10px;
    color: #333333;
    line-height: 20px;
    border-color: #5b6db5;
    border-style: solid;
    border-width: 1px;
    padding :5px;
}

td.ErrorPanel
{
    font-family: Tahoma, Verdana;
    font-size: 10px;
    color: #FF0000;
    line-height: 12px;
    text-align: justify;
    border-top: #5b6db5 2px double;
}

td.LAlign
{
    font-family: Tahoma, Verdana;
    font-size: 10px;
    color: #333333;
    line-height: 20px;
    text-align: left;
}

td.RAlign
{
    font-family: Tahoma, Verdana;
    font-size: 10px;
    color: #333333;
    line-height: 20px;
    text-align: right;
}

td.LAlign1
{
    font-family: Tahoma, Verdana;
    font-size: 11px;
    color: #990000;
    line-height: 20px;
    text-align: left;
}

td.RAlign1
{
    font-family: Tahoma, Verdana;
    font-size: 11px;
    font-weight: bold;
    color: #333333;
    line-height: 20px;
    text-align: right;
}
td.CAlign
{
    font-family: Tahoma, Verdana;
    font-size: 10px;
    color: #333333;
    line-height: 20px;
    text-align: center;
}

.txtBox
{
    background-color:#F5F5F5;
    font-family: Tahoma, Verdana;
    font-size: 10px;
    color: #333333;
    text-align: justify;
    border-color: #DCDCDC;
    border-style: inset;
    border-width: 1px;
    height: 14px;
    text-transform: uppercase;
}

A.lnkBar:link
{
	font-family: Tahoma, Verdana;
	font-size: 10px;
	color: white;
	line-height: 20px;
}

A.lnkBar:visited
{
    font-family: Tahoma, Verdana;
    font-size: 10px;
    color: white;
    line-height: 20px;
}

A.lnkBar:hover
{
    font-family: Tahoma, Verdana;
    font-size: 10px;
    font-weight: bold;
    color: white;
    line-height: 20px;
}

div.Progress
{
    font-family: Tahoma, Verdana;
    font-size: 9px;
    font-weight: bold;
    color: #000099;
    line-height: 12px;
    background-image: url(./images/progress_bar1.gif);
    background-repeat: no-repeat;
    background-position-x: right;
}

td.Error
{
    font-family: Tahoma, Verdana;
    font-size: 16px;
    color: #ff0000;
    text-align: justify;
    font-weight: bold;
}

tr.TableHeader
{
    height: 20px;
    font-family: Tahoma, Verdana;
    font-size: 12px;
    color: #7d6a4b;
    text-align: center;
    font-weight: bold;
}

tr.hrHeader
{
    border-color:LightSteelBlue;
    border-style:solid;
    border-width:1px;
    font-family:Verdana;
    font-size:10px;
    border-spacing:1px;
    background-color:#7d6a4b;
    color:#FFFFFF;
    height:20px;       
}

tr.hr1
{
	border-color: LightSteelBlue;
	border-style: solid;
	border-width: 1px;
	font-family: Verdana;
	font-size: 10px;
	text-align: left;
	border-spacing: 1px;
	background-color:#f7ecd0;
	color: #333333;
	height: 20px;
	line-height: 14px;
}

tr.hr2
{
    border-color:LightSteelBlue;
    border-style:solid;
    border-width:1px;
    font-family:Verdana;
    font-size:10px;
    text-align:left;
    border-spacing:1px;
    background-color:#f7ecd0;
    color:#333333;
    height:20px;       
    line-height:14px;
}
td.LAlign1PANELSTATIC
{
    font-family: Tahoma, Verdana;
    font-size: 11px;
   color: #333333;
    line-height: 20px;
    text-align: left;
    font-weight :bold;
    
}

td.LAlign1PANELDYNAMIC
{
    font-family: Tahoma, Verdana;
    font-size: 11px;
    font-weight: bold;
    color: #990000;
    line-height: 20px;
    text-align: left;
}


